Default Which City to live in MA along I-90 between Longmeadow and Sturbridge MA ?

Hi All,

My wife, myself and our 5 year old will relocate to Massachusetts for job reason. My wife will work in Longmeadow MA and I will in Framingham, MA. I would like to commute via I-90 and want to drive more time than my wife. So I narrowed it down to somewhere between Longmeadow and Sturbridge along I-90. I have not lived in MA before (we will be visiting before we move to be sure) . We have no clue on where to start but I would GREATLY appreciate any help anyone can offer. Here is our criteria....

- We would like an area low crime and family friendly.
- Awesome schools....not good but Awesome.
- Commute time to Longmeadow would have to be 40mins or less.
- Affordable....we are looking at about 300 k.
- Good Community and easy shopping for my wife

I would have to say that your best bet is Sturbridge. Palmer is somehat removed and kind of on the depressing side. Stafford Springs, CT is rural and I don't believe the schools are stellar there.

Sturbridge is a nice historic New England town. There is a fair amount of shops, restaurants etc. and it has a small town feel. It has easy access to the Mass Pike and points south. I believe the schools are fairly decent...not overly strong, but good. Sturbridge has expereinced significant growth over the last few years primarily due to it being at a crossroads (Pike and I-84).

You may want to look into Wilbraham (further commute for you) and Charlton as well. Logmeadow is probably everything you are looking for and more, but I think it is too much of a commute for you.
